Traditional upholstery cleaning actually accelerates re-soiling in Georgetown's environment. When cleaners use soap-based solutions, they leave invisible residue that acts like a magnet for those agricultural particles floating through your home. Within days of cleaning, the sticky residue attracts more fine dust than before, creating the frustrating cycle where furniture looks worse faster. The agricultural particulates bond to soap residue at the molecular level, forming dense accumulations that darken fabrics. This residue-attraction cycle explains why conventionally cleaned upholstery in Georgetown often appears dirty again within a week, despite the homeowner's investment in professional cleaning.
